? Key Features
• Unique Shape: These tomatoes have a pear-like shape with vertical ribbing, making them a standout in your garden. ?
• Disease Resistance: Tolerant to Fusarium and Verticillium, these tomatoes promote healthy plant growth. ?
• High Yield: Expect generous harvests, with each fruit averaging 250-300 grams (8.8-10.5 oz). ??
• Consistent Ripening: Enjoy fully ripened tomatoes without the green shoulders. ?

? Growing Instructions
• Sowing Depth: Plant seeds 1.5–2 cm (0.6–0.8 inches) deep. ?
• Planting Distance:
Tall Varieties: 80x25 cm (31.5x10 inches)
Short Varieties: 50x25 cm (20x10 inches) ?
• Soil Preference: Prefers deep, well-drained, and fertile soils. ?
• Seeding Rate: 3–4 grams per 100 m (approximately 0.02 oz per 1,076 sq ft). ?
• Vegetation Period: Approximately 100-110 days from planting to harvest. ?
• Seedling Rate: 30–40 grams per decare (approximately 0.1 hectares or 0.25 acres). ?
? Fun Fact
The Heart of Albenga tomato, originally from Italy, has gained popularity in Bulgarian gardens due to its high yield and delicious flavor. Its name comes from the Italian town of Albenga, renowned for its agricultural heritage. ?
